For Shining Oak (she/her), activism and queerness have been catalysts for reconnecting to her Jewish faith. Learn about Shining Oak's experiences with the movement to Stop Cop City, from organizing a kid-friendly event for a 2021 Week of Action to attending a powerful Shabbat service in Atlanta's Weelaunee Forest.

Talking Points:

(0:00) A new nonviolent movement space; introducing Shining Oak — queer Jewish forest defender

(3:30) First week of action in spring 2021; organizing a kid-friendly event

(9:10) Comparing then and now — larger numbers, more widespread, clearing begun

(15:00) The power of a diverse movement — Jewish members, queer members, BIPOC members, and more

(19:53) Shabbat in the forest

(24:55) Growing up Jewish in a white Christian suburb — pressure to assimilate

(30:45) Get involved with the movement in your own small way; honor Tortuguita's memory

(36:20 - end) Wrapping up with a Jewish rabbi's story of Purim in the forest
